3 day gorilla safari to Parc National des Volcanoes – home of abour 300 mountain gorillas located in the north of Rwanda. Volcanoes national park comprises of ten habituated gorilla families – each of the groups allows up to 8 gorilla trekkers per day. In Volcanoes national park, you can track gorillas, climb the Visoke volcano, track the golden monkeys or visit the Dian Fossey Karisoke Research Centre.
